Largest Available Avoca and Nearby 1 Bedroom Apartments

The largest available 1 Bedroom apartment unit in Avoca, MI is found at Anchor Bay Apartments in the New Baltimore neighborhood and is 950 square feet priced from $850. Silver Pines Apartments in the Downtown Port Huron neighborhood has the second largest 1 Bedroom, which is sized at 920 square feet and currently listed start at $970. Cheapest Available Avoca and Nearby 1 Bedroom Apartments

As of May 15, 2025 the lowest priced 1 Bedroom apartment unit in Avoca, MI is the One Bedrom Model starting from $680 at Croswell Country Manor - 62+ Senior Community . The second most affordable Avoca 1 Bedroom is the 1 Bedroom Model at Anchor Bay Apartments starting at $850 in the New Baltimore neighborhood. The average price for all 1 Bedroom apartments in Avoca is currently $992. Here is today’s list of the cheapest available 1 Bedroom options in Avoca:
